
It's easy to think about the homeless when blustery, below-zero temperatures make us wonder: How do people survive without shelter? But agencies that serve the homeless experience sharp decreases in donations and volunteers during the summer. Candace of the the Open Door Mission reminds us that--due to ailments like dehydration and heat exhaustion--summertime is NOT necessarily the "right time" to have to live on the streets.
